Clinical Audit Tool
Notice Description
The project aims to procure, where possible, a turn-key commercial off the shelf solution to replace in-house developed tools, for the conduct of clinical audit. Following successful delivery and acceptance of the system the Trust wishes to engage the supplier for operational maintenance and support services. The high-level scope requires an audit tool that: 1. Can interface with in-service systems such as electronic patient record and computer aided dispatch and/or the NWAS data warehouse to import data required to complete regulatory audits, e.g. ambulance care quality indicator (ACQI) returns and/or to conduct local discretionary audits. 2. Can record, store and report on the audits required for NWAS integrated contact centre to maintain their licence to operate the various clinical decision support systems, e.g. NHS Pathways, used in the trust.
Planning Information
A one-hour market engagement session will be held on Microsoft Teams on Friday 1st August from 10:30am to 11:30am. The purpose of this session is to inform potential suppliers of a forthcoming opportunity to tender for a digital clinical audit tool (CAT) solution for North West Ambulance Service NHS Trust (NWAS). NWAS will present an overview of the current state for conducting audits and articulate the future business needs. Afterwards, a question and answer document containing specific technical questions will be issued to all suppliers who have expressed an interest in this notice. Suppliers will be asked to submit any responses by Friday 8th August. Any information obtained by the Trust through this market engagement will be used solely to conceptualise how the system can be realised, considering the various data sources. The Trust will take care to ensure that any amendments made to the specification, based on the responses received to the questionnaire, do not favour any one supplier or solution. The findings and outcome of this market engagement will be published in the ITT documentation. Any confidential information including intellectual property must be identified by any suppliers submitting responses to the question and answer document. Any such information will not be published in the ITT. NWAS have scheduled to publish the ITT on Friday 15th August, however, this date is subject to change. Procurement is estimated to be completed by November 2025.
